A central atom with five pairs of bonding electron pairs is known as trigonal bipyramidal. It has the shape of three pairs in a plane at 120° angles (the trigonal planar geometry) and the remaining two pairs at 90° angles to the plane. WebLewis structure of Phosphine molecule contains three sigma bonds and one lone pair around phosphorus atom. Therefore, there are total of four electrons regions. So, hybridization of phosphorus atom is sp 3. Because there are four electrons regions, geometry is tetrahedral and shape is trigonal pyramidal.
